    ESSENTIAL SELF-TRAINING SKILLS TO BECOME AN INTERPRETER: ENGLISH-MAJORING STUDENTS’ PERCEPTION

    Get PDF
    Currently, interpreting has become a profession in high demand. This study surveyed students' perceptions of the essential self-training skills to become an interpreter. The study used a questionnaire to collect data collection tool which was a survey with 12 multiple-choice questions and 4 open-ended questions. 82 English–majoring students of High-quality program Batch 45 – at Can Tho University participated in the survey. The results show that students majoring in High-quality English Language perceive the importance of skills in interpreting: shorthand skills, listening comprehension skills, memorization skills, visualization skills, presentation skills, skills in using search engines, teamwork skills, multi-tasking skills, and pronunciation skills. Students also pointed out a number of skills that they think are equally important if they want to become an interpreter such as reflexes, situational skills, and contextual skills. On that basis, a number of measures of how to support students to develop their own training plans and hone their skills for their future careers are proposed.  Article visualizations

    TYPES OF POLITENESS STRATEGIES AND DEGREES OF POLITENESS PERFORMED BY ENGLISH MAJOR STUDENTS IN REQUESTING FOR HELP

    Get PDF
    In social interaction, people need to pay attention to the face of others to maintain relationships and avoid losing their faces. To do this, people should use politeness strategies in communication. This study aims to investigate which type of politeness strategies are mostly used and the level of politeness shown by English major students in the High Quality Program in requesting help. This study is based on the theory of Brown and Levinson (1987). Based on the analysis of the data obtained from the questionnaire, negative politeness strategies were applied the most. This also performs a high degree of politeness.     An Improved MobileNet for Disease Detection on Tomato Leaves

    Get PDF
    Tomatoes are widely grown vegetables, and farmers face challenges in caring for them, particularly regarding plant diseases. The MobileNet architecture is renowned for its simplicity and compatibility with mobile devices. This study introduces MobileNet as a deep learning model to enhance disease detection efficiency in tomato plants. The model is evaluated on a dataset of 2,064 tomato leaf images, encompassing early blight, leaf spot, yellow curl, and healthy leaves. Results demonstrate promising accuracy, exceeding 0.980 for disease classification and 0.975 for distinguishing between diseases and healthy cases. Moreover, the proposed model outperforms existing approaches in terms of accuracy and training time for plant leaf disease detection

    Scaling up the use of low-emissions development (LED) research outputs in Vietnam: Co-design of LED research priorities, outputs, and impact pathways for emissions reduction from the livestock sector

    Get PDF
    Key messages – Using a rational formulation tool (PC Dairy Software) with locally available feeds can increase productivity and income of dairy farmers and reduce methane emissions. This requires building the capacity of policymakers, extension officers, dairy farmers, and feed industries to facilitate the use of the livestock PC Dairy Software and the national deed database. – Co-designing low-emissions development (LED) research priorities, outputs, and impact pathways with user input ensures relevant research and generates impact. This helps develop and refine research outputs, communication with stakeholders, and integration into LED policies and strategies. – Promoting improved feed by using the national feed database and PC Dairy Software can contribute to achieving Vietnam’s greenhouse gas (GHG) reduction targets set in the nationally determined contribution (NDC) and green growth strategy (GGS)

    HMU fluorinze mouthwash enhances enamel remineralization: An in vitro study

    Get PDF
    BACKGROUND: Fluoride therapy has long been used extensively to prevent dental caries. Fluoride appears in variety of dental care products such as mouthrinse, dentifrice, gel, etc. HMU fluorinze is the first mouthwash containing fluoride in Vietnam. AIM: This research was conducted to evaluate the efficacy of HMU Fluorinze mouthwash on remineralizing enamel in laboratory conditions. METHODS: 20 third molars teeth were cleaned and covered with nail polish , except for a 3x3 mm square on their buccal surfaces. These teeth went through two steps: demineralization using Coke and remineralization for 20 days: 1) using standard calcifying solution (control group) and 2) using standard calcifying solution + HMU Fluorinze mouthwash 2 times/day (experimental group). The mineralization index of enamel structure after demineralization and remineralization was assessed by DIAGNOdent pen 2190. RESULTS: The mineralization indexes of the control group and experimental group at baseline were 3.65 ± 0.76 and 3.35 ± 0.64, after demineralization were in turn of 21.78 ± 4.48 and 20.25 ± 2.26; and after remineralization were 6.30 ± 1.03 and 3.90 ± 1.24. The different figures  between the two groups after remineralization shows statistical significance (p<0.01). Group B using HMU fluorinze mouthwash after 20 days did not differ from the original results (p = 0.272), in contrast with the control group (p<0.01). CONCLUSIONS: HMU fluorinze mouthwash has better mineralization effect than standard calcifying solution

    Challenges and Lessons Learned in the Development of a Participatory Learning and Action Intervention to Tackle Antibiotic Resistance: Experiences From Northern Vietnam

    Get PDF
    Antibiotic use in the community for humans and animals is high in Vietnam, driven by easy access to over-the counter medicines and poor understanding of the role of antibiotics. This has contributed to antibiotic resistance levels that are amongst the highest in the world. To address this problem, we developed a participatory learning and action (PLA) intervention. Here we describe challenges and lessons learned while developing and testing this intervention in preparation for a large-scale One Health trial in northern Vietnam. We tested the PLA approach using community-led photography, and then reflected on how this approach worked in practice. We reviewed and discussed implementation documentation and developed and refined themes. Five main themes were identified related to challenges and lessons learned: understanding the local context, stakeholder relationship development, participant recruitment, building trust and motivation, and engagement with the topic of antibiotics and antimicrobial resistance (AMR). Partnerships with national and local authorities provided an important foundation for building relationships with communities, and enhanced visibility and credibility of activities. Partnership development required managing relationships, clarifying roles, and accommodating different management styles. When recruiting participants, we had to balance preferences for top-down and bottom-up approaches. Building trust and motivation took time and was challenged by limited study team presence in the community. Open discussions around expectations and appropriate incentives were re-visited throughout the process. Financial incentives provided initial motivation to participate, while less tangible benefits like collective knowledge, social connections, desire to help the community, and new skills, sustained longer-term motivation. Lack of awareness and perceived importance of the problem of AMR, affected initial motivation. Developing mutual understanding through use of common and simplified language helped when discussing the complexities of this topic. A sense of ownership emerged as the study progressed and participants understood more about AMR, how it related to their own concerns, and incorporated their own ideas into activities. PLA can be a powerful way of stimulating community action and bringing people together to tackle a common problem. Understanding the nuances of local power structures, and allowing time for stakeholder relationship development and consensus-building are important considerations when designing engagement projects
